The Location of the Morrison Cemetery ...

We are using the following GPS coordinates (latitude and longitude) for the Morrison Cemetery:

39.7125, -96.3530

Note: The GPS location that we are using for the Morrison Cemetery can be traced back to the Geographic Names Information System (GNIS)<1>

The Morrison Cemetery is located in Marshall County<2>.

The county seat for Marshall County is located in Marysville. Marysville lies 17 miles [27.4 km]<3> to the west northwest of the Morrison Cemetery .
